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Darnall to Marton start from as little as £11.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Darnall to Marton start from £72.60 one way, or £73.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Darnall to Marton are available for £81.20 one way, or £162.10 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Darnall might be a smaller station with a touch of old-world simplicity, but it's designed to accommodate passengers with fundamental needs. While there's no formal ticket office, ticket machines are handy for any collections or purchases, although they're currently not accessible. If you're tech-savvy, collecting tickets bought online from these machines is straightforward. While staff assistance isn't present, help points and announcements are your go-to for any immediate guidance.

Accessibility is a standout feature, with the station rated as Category A, indicating step-free access throughout. A ramped subway provides convenience for wheelchair users, though it is noteworthy that there are no accessible ticket machines or facilities such as toilets or waiting rooms available. Facilities at Marton Station

Marton Station is designed with accessibility in mind, boasting step-free access across its structures. Pragmatic in its approach, the station contains ticket machines for purchasing or collecting tickets bought online. Plus, these machines are accessible to users with mobility impairments.

Customer service is streamlined with help points scattered around the platform, despite the lack of onsite staff. Departures can be monitored easily with departure screens, and announcements keep commuters informed. However, facilities such as waiting rooms, public W-Fi, and toilets are not available on-site, so it's wise to plan accordingly.

Seamless Travel Connections

Connecting your journey beyond the platform is simple at Marton Station. With bus stops located conveniently nearby, public transport links to Middlesbrough and surrounding areas are at your fingertips. Travelers intending to use taxi services should look up Cab Services for options, though it's worth noting there's no designated taxi rank at the station.

For those interested in cycling, Marton provides some bike storage options. Four spaces within the car park offer stands for securing bicycles, though these are unsheltered. Unfortunately, bicycle hire is not yet available directly from the station.
